Girl group HOT ISSUE to disband 4 days before their 1-year anniversary

AKP STAFF

On April 22, rookie girl group HOT ISSUE's label S2 Entertainment delivered unfortunate news for fans.

The label revealed on this day, 

"Hello, this is S2 Entertainment. 
First, we would like to apologize for bringing sudden news to the fans who have loved and supported HOT ISSUE. 
After a lengthy discussion with our artists, the company and the members have collectively come to the decision to disband the team. 
The company continuously worked with the artists for a long time toward the direction and development we were aiming for, but ultimately, the above decision was inevitable. 
The company would like to express our apologies and gratitude to the fans who have loved and cared for HOT ISSUE until now. Please look forward to the HOT ISSUE members' future activities from now on. Thank you."

Meanwhile, HOT ISSUE debuted in the K-Pop scene back on April 28, 2021 with the release of their 1st mini album, 'Issue Maker' and title track "GRATATA". Fans were expecting to celebrate HOT ISSUE's 1-year debut anniversary this coming April 28.
